NP. Having a "step goal" is a rough recommendation to just get a little activity. But if you get 5,000 steps running or 5,000 steps going up stairs, those will be better for you than slow putzing around. Think quality, not quantity. 10k steps of putzing around is definitely better than nothing, but ideally one should do something that gets their heart pumping. |
Cardio exercise is certainly an important part of the equation. But as you age its important to maintain movement for bones, joints, and balance. So walking - which is low impact - if done regularly you are helping out a lot of your body. And it is certainly better than no movement at all. So while 10K was an arbitrary figure - it's not a bad goal to aim for. Lower than 3000 k isn't doing much for your over all. |
